I recently read an incredible book titled 'How to be Miserable' by the incredible Randy J Peterson. A controversial take on traditional self-help books, this book doesn't aim to tell you how to be happier, it instead tells you what you're already doing that might be getting in the way. In this episode, I talk about some of my favourite chapters, highlighting why perfectionism, avoidance and assumptions can have such negative impacts on our wellbeing. Using psychological theories and witty retorts, this book allowed me to think about things in life in a way I never have done before, and I really wanted to share with you some of the sections which resonated me with the most.
